I was thinking, would be, a way, to improve tecnology automatically, without creating a new item?
I mean, keep using the same item (armor, or weapon) but better, using the scientist research.?
-
not as such, no, but you could make a separate manufacturing definition for the upgraded armor to allow you to "trade in" your old ones for the new stuff, at a much lower cost and amount of time than making a fresh suit from raw materials. you could also make it almost instantaneous and completely free, but it would still require you to do it manually.
-
Discovering new ammo for weapons (alien alloy ammo for firearms, better power packs for lasers, etc.) can sort of achieve that too, but it all goes through manufacturing. Otherwise, how would and item change?

another question
is it possible put a limit to the item manufacturation?
-
What kind of a limit?
-
for example just build one armor, not more of one
-
Well, I assume "a single UNIQUE item in the entire game"? If so, there is no good way of doing this, except maybe putting an unique item in the starting base inventory (OR starting transfers: "your ultracool item is scheduled to arrive at your starting base in 300 days!), an item that's needed for such manufacture and cannot be acquired in any way.
